Cost of Living: Bellflower, CA vs Portage, WI
Housing
The housing market plays a significant role in determining the cost of living.
Metric | Bellflower | Portage |
---|---|---|
Housing Index | 135.0 | 120.0 |
Median Home Price | $650,000 | $193,500 |
Average Rent (2 BR Apartment) | $2400 | $1250 |
Average Rent (2 BR House) | $2456 | $1300 |
Housing Comparison: Bellflower vs Portage
- In Bellflower, the median home price is higher at $650,000, while in Portage it is $193,500.
- Renting a two-bedroom apartment costs more in Bellflower at $2,400 than in Portage at $1,250.
Utilities
The cost of utilities such as electricity, natural gas, and other services can significantly impact the overall cost of living.
Metric | Bellflower | Portage |
---|---|---|
Electricity Price | $32.99 | $17.6 |
Natural Gas Price | $16.99 | $11.5 |
Other Utilities | $290 | $250 |
Utilities Comparison: Bellflower vs Portage
- Electricity costs are higher in Bellflower at $32.99 per kWh, compared to $17.6 in Portage.
- Natural gas is more expensive in Bellflower at $16.99 per unit, while it is cheaper at $11.5 in Portage.
- Other utility costs are higher in Bellflower at an average of $290, compared to Portage with $250.
